Here’s a poem structured as a series of quatrains, each corresponding to a phrase from the Lord’s Prayer (based on the traditional version from Matthew 6:9-13 in the Christian Bible: “Our Father, which art in heaven, Hallowed be thy Name, Thy kingdom come, Thy will be done in earth as it is in heaven, Give us this day our daily bread, And forgive us our trespasses, As we forgive them that trespass against us, And lead us not into temptation, But deliver us from evil”). I’ll assume the concluding doxology (“For thine is the kingdom, the power, and the glory, forever and ever”) is included, as it’s often part of liturgical use. Each quatrain reflects on its respective phrase with a consistent rhyme scheme (ABAB) for unity.

Our Father, which art in heaven,


Above the earth, enthroned in light,
Thy love descends to hearts bereaven,
A Father’s care through endless night.

Hallowed be thy Name,


Thy title echoes, pure and grand,
No tongue can sully sacred fame,
Revered by souls in every land.

Thy kingdom come,


We plead for peace, thy reign to see,
A world where strife at last is numb,
And all bow down in unity.

Thy will be done in earth as it is in heaven,


Thy purpose bends both time and space,
On soil and sky thy law is given,
To mirror heaven’s holy grace.

Give us this day our daily bread,


Each morn thy bounty freely flows,
By thee our hungry souls are fed,
Sustained through all life’s joys and woes.

And forgive us our trespasses,


Our sins, like chains, we cast to thee,
Thy mercy heals where guilt amasses,
And sets the burdened spirit free.

As we forgive them that trespass against us,


As thou dost pardon, so must we,
Release the debts that once oppress us,
In love’s forgiving liberty.

And lead us not into temptation,


Guard us from paths where shadows lure,
Thy hand prevents our soul’s frustration,
And keeps our wandering steps secure.

But deliver us from evil,


From darkness deep, thy power saves,
Against the foe, thy strength is civil,
Redeeming us from sin’s dark waves.

For thine is the kingdom, the power, and the glory,


All realms, all might, all praise is thine,
Eternal song of sacred story,
Forever shines thy reign divine.

Forever and ever,


Beyond the stars, thy will holds sway,
Time’s end shall bind thee never,
Eternal Lord of endless day.

The poem, presented as A Majestic Sonnet Declaring That a Nation Shall Rise in Greatness by Exalting Jesus Christ, Following the Holy Bible, and Embracing His Most Holy Ways, is a poetic call for a nation to achieve greatness through faith. It portrays a people bowing to God’s command (Psalm 95:6, “Come, let us bow down in worship”), blessed as a land where He reigns as King (Psalm 33:12, “Blessed is the nation whose God is the Lord”). The Bible is their shield (Ephesians 6:16, “the shield of faith”), guiding them through trials to a promised home (John 14:2-3, Christ preparing a place). God’s glory envelops them (Exodus 24:17, His glory as a consuming fire), and their greatness dawns by exalting Jesus Christ (Philippians 2:9-11, every knee bowing to His name) and living His holy ways (1 Peter 1:15, “Be holy, for I am holy”). It’s a fearless anthem of praise, rooted in scripture, for a righteous nation.

A nation bows beneath the Lord’s command,
For blessed is the land where He is King,
His chosen flock, upheld by sovereign hand,
In psalms of grace, their fervent voices ring.
Through trials fierce, we cling to faith unbowed,
The Bible’s word, our shield against the fray,
No storm can break the promise He avowed,
To guide us home along the narrow way.
“Blessed is the nation,” scripture cries aloud,
Whose God is Lord, whose heart in trust abides,
From sea to sea, His glory shall enshroud,
A people free, where righteousness resides.
So fearless, let us lift His name in praise,
Greatness dawns through Christ’s most holy ways.

The sonnet, inspired by Psalm 34:4, explores the speaker’s journey from fear to peace through divine intervention. It begins with the speaker describing their state of distress, overwhelmed by fear, and their desperate prayer to God. Referencing Psalm 34:4 (“I prayed to the Lord, and He answered me”), the poem highlights how God listens to the speaker’s plea and responds with grace, dispelling their fears. The imagery shifts from darkness to light, symbolizing the transition from despair to hope as God’s love restores the speaker’s soul. The sonnet concludes with a call to trust in God’s unwavering support during trials, affirming that His grace is a constant source of comfort in times of need.

When shadows fall and fears begin to rise,
I lift my voice, a trembling, broken plea,
To heavens high, where mercy never dies,
The Lord, my refuge, bends His ear to me.

He hears the cries that echo through the night,
And with His grace, He calms my troubled soul,
In darkest hours, He brings a dawning light,
His gentle hand restores and makes me whole.

In time of need, His love does not delay,
A boundless gift, unmerited, so free,
My heart, once lost, now finds the brighter way,
For He has answered, setting fear to flee.

So let us trust, in every trial we face,
The Lord will hear, and answer with His grace.

The sonnet draws from Matthew 24, depicting the end-time signs—wars, earthquakes, false prophets, famines, and lawlessness—as the world darkens. Amid this chaos, the gospel spreads globally, a light before the end. At an unknown hour, the rapture comes with a trumpet’s call, lifting the faithful to Christ in hope, offering escape and eternal comfort to believers watching for His return.

The wars and rumors echo through the air,
The earth in tremors groans beneath our feet,
False prophets rise, their words a cunning snare,
While famine’s shadow stalks where once was wheat.
The nations clash, the skies grow dark with dread,
Lawlessness reigns, and love begins to fade,
Yet gospel’s light through every land is spread,
A beacon bright before the final blade.
In sudden hour, none but God can know,
The trumpet sounds, the heavens split apart,
The chosen rise where clouds in glory flow,
Caught up in hope to meet the Savior’s heart.
So watch, dear soul, though chaos grips the day,
His coming steals the faithful swift away.
